技术博客
惊喜好礼享不停
技术博客
Poco:小而mighty的在线分析处理工具

Poco:小而mighty的在线分析处理工具

作者: 万维易源
2024-08-23
PocoOLAPWebDataCode

摘要

本文将介绍一款名为 'poco' 的在线分析处理(OLAP)工具,该工具虽然名字在西班牙语和意大利语中意为“小”,却拥有强大的数据仓库报告展示能力。值得注意的是,'poco' 并不包含 OLAP 服务器或数据挖掘解决方案。为了帮助读者更好地理解和使用 'poco',本文提供了多个代码示例,以便于读者直观地掌握其功能和应用场景。

关键词

Poco, OLAP, Web, Data, Code

一、Poco概述

1.1 什么是Poco?

在当今这个数据驱动的时代,如何高效地管理和分析海量数据成为了企业和组织面临的重大挑战。正是在这种背景下,“Poco”应运而生。“Poco”这个名字源自西班牙语和意大利语,意为“小”,但它所蕴含的功能和潜力却远超其名。它不是一个传统的OLAP服务器或数据挖掘解决方案,而是一款基于Web的、轻量级的数据仓库报告展示平台。通过简洁直观的界面,“Poco”让用户能够轻松地探索和理解复杂的数据集,从而做出更加明智的决策。

1.2 Poco的特点

“Poco”的设计初衷是为用户提供一种简单易用而又功能强大的数据分析工具。以下是它的一些显著特点:

  • 轻量级且易于部署:“Poco”不需要复杂的安装过程,用户可以在短时间内完成部署并开始使用,极大地节省了时间和资源。
  • 灵活的数据接入:支持多种数据源接入,包括但不限于SQL数据库、CSV文件等,使得数据整合变得更加便捷。
  • 丰富的可视化选项:提供多样化的图表类型,如柱状图、折线图、饼图等,帮助用户从不同角度解读数据。
  • 交互式报告:用户可以通过简单的拖拽操作定制个性化的报告模板,实现数据的即时分析和展示。
  • 代码示例辅助学习:为了让用户更快上手,“Poco”还提供了详尽的文档和实用的代码示例,即便是初学者也能快速掌握其使用技巧。

通过这些特点可以看出,“Poco”不仅仅是一款工具,更是连接数据与洞察之间的桥梁,它让每个人都能成为数据的主人。

二、Poco入门

2.1 Poco的安装和配置

在探索“Poco”的强大功能之前,首先需要了解如何将其安装到您的系统中。安装过程简单明了,即使是技术新手也能轻松完成。以下是安装步骤概览:

  1. 下载安装包:访问“Poco”的官方网站,根据您的操作系统选择合适的安装包进行下载。
  2. 解压文件:将下载好的安装包解压缩至您希望存放的位置。
  3. 配置环境:确保您的系统已安装了必要的依赖项,例如Node.js和npm。如果尚未安装,请先完成这些基础软件的安装。
  4. 启动服务:“Poco”通过命令行启动,只需打开终端或命令提示符,导航至解压后的文件夹路径,输入npm start即可启动服务。

配置指南

为了让“Poco”更好地适应您的需求,还需要进行一些基本的配置。这包括设置数据源、调整界面样式等个性化选项。具体步骤如下:

  1. 数据源配置:打开config.json文件,在其中添加您的数据源信息,包括数据库类型、连接字符串等。
  2. 界面定制:同样在config.json文件中,您可以找到关于界面样式的配置选项,比如主题颜色、字体大小等,根据个人喜好进行调整。
  3. 安全性设置:考虑到数据安全的重要性,“Poco”还提供了用户权限管理功能。管理员可以设置不同的访问级别,确保敏感数据的安全。

通过以上步骤,您就可以顺利地安装并配置好“Poco”,准备开始您的数据分析之旅了。

2.2 Poco的基本使用

一旦“Poco”安装配置完毕,接下来就是体验它的魅力时刻了。下面将详细介绍如何利用“Poco”进行基本的数据分析操作。

数据导入

首先,需要将您的数据导入到“Poco”中。支持的数据源非常广泛,包括但不限于SQL数据库、CSV文件等。只需在界面上选择相应的数据源类型,按照提示完成数据导入即可。

数据探索

数据导入完成后,就可以开始探索数据了。通过“Poco”的直观界面,您可以轻松地筛选、排序数据,甚至创建自定义视图来深入分析特定的数据集。

可视化分析

“Poco”提供了丰富的图表类型供您选择,如柱状图、折线图、饼图等。只需简单地拖拽字段到图表区域,即可生成相应的图表。此外,还可以对图表进行进一步的定制,比如调整颜色、添加注释等,使数据呈现更加生动有趣。

报告制作

最后,利用“Poco”的报告功能,可以将分析结果整理成专业的报告形式。不仅支持文本描述,还能直接嵌入图表,方便分享给团队成员或客户。

通过上述步骤,即使是数据分析的新手也能迅速掌握“Poco”的基本使用方法,开启您的数据探索之旅。

三、Poco的核心功能

3.1 Poco的数据处理能力

在这个数据爆炸的时代,如何从海量的信息中提炼出有价值的知识,成为了每个企业和组织必须面对的挑战。而“Poco”,这款小巧却功能强大的在线分析处理工具,正以其独特的魅力,引领着数据处理的新潮流。它不仅仅是一个简单的数据展示平台,更是一个能够帮助用户深入挖掘数据背后故事的强大助手。

灵活的数据接入方式

“Poco”支持多种数据源接入,无论是SQL数据库还是CSV文件,甚至是Excel表格,都能够轻松接入。这种灵活性使得数据整合变得异常简便,用户无需担心数据格式的问题,便能将注意力集中在数据分析本身上。

强大的数据处理引擎

“Poco”的数据处理引擎经过精心设计,能够高效地处理各种规模的数据集。无论数据量多大,它都能保持流畅的操作体验,确保用户能够快速获得所需的结果。这种高性能的表现,得益于其背后的优化算法和技术架构。

智能的数据筛选与排序

在“Poco”中,用户可以通过简单的拖拽操作,对数据进行筛选和排序。这一功能极大地简化了数据分析的过程,让用户能够更加专注于数据本身,而不是繁琐的操作流程。此外,“Poco”还支持自定义视图,用户可以根据自己的需求,创建个性化的数据视图,从而更深入地探索数据的内在联系。

3.2 Poco的报表生成功能

在完成了数据的处理和分析之后,如何将这些成果有效地呈现出来,成为了另一个关键环节。“Poco”在这方面也做得相当出色,它不仅提供了丰富的图表类型,还支持高度定制化的报告制作功能。

多样化的图表类型

“Poco”内置了多种图表类型,包括但不限于柱状图、折线图、饼图等。这些图表不仅美观大方,而且能够直观地展示数据的趋势和分布情况。用户只需简单地拖拽字段到图表区域,即可生成相应的图表,大大降低了制作图表的技术门槛。

定制化的报告模板

除了图表之外,“Poco”还允许用户创建个性化的报告模板。这意味着用户可以根据自己的需求,自由地安排报告的结构和布局,甚至可以添加文字说明和图片,使得报告内容更加丰富多样。这种高度的定制化,不仅提升了报告的专业度,也让分享成果变得更加容易。

通过“Poco”的这些功能,即使是数据分析的新手,也能轻松地制作出专业级别的报告,将复杂的数据转化为易于理解的故事,为决策提供有力的支持。

四、Poco的实践应用

4.1 Poco的代码示例

在探索“Poco”的世界时,没有什么比亲手尝试更能让人深刻理解其功能了。为此,我们精心挑选了几段代码示例,旨在帮助读者快速上手并深入了解“Poco”的工作原理。

示例1: 数据源配置

假设您正在使用MySQL作为数据源,以下是如何在config.json文件中配置数据源的一个简单示例:

{
  "dataSource": {
    "type": "mysql",
    "host": "localhost",
    "port": 3306,
    "database": "my_database",
    "user": "root",
    "password": "mypassword"
  }
}

这段代码展示了如何指定数据库类型、主机地址、端口、数据库名称以及登录凭据。通过这样的配置,您可以轻松地将“Poco”与您的MySQL数据库连接起来,开始进行数据分析。

示例2: 创建自定义视图

“Poco”允许用户创建自定义视图来深入探索数据。以下是一个简单的示例,展示了如何通过简单的拖拽操作创建一个视图,用于显示销售额最高的前五名产品:

  1. 打开数据表:在“Poco”的主界面中,选择您想要分析的数据表。
  2. 筛选数据:在左侧的数据列中,选择“销售额”列,并设置降序排列。
  3. 限制行数:在右侧的视图设置中,限制显示的行数为5。

通过这样的操作,您就能快速得到一个清晰的视图,展示销售额最高的前五名产品及其相关信息。

示例3: 图表定制

“Poco”提供了丰富的图表类型,让您能够以最直观的方式展示数据。以下是如何创建一个折线图,以展示过去一年内每月的销售趋势:

  1. 选择数据列:在数据表中选择“日期”和“销售额”两列。
  2. 创建图表:点击图表图标,选择“折线图”。
  3. 调整图表设置:将“日期”列拖拽到X轴,将“销售额”列拖拽到Y轴。
  4. 定制样式:在图表设置中,可以选择不同的颜色方案、添加标题和图例等。

通过这样的步骤,您就能得到一个清晰展示销售趋势的折线图,帮助您更好地理解业务表现。

4.2 Poco的实践应用

“Poco”不仅仅是一款工具,它更是一种思维方式的转变。让我们来看看几个实际案例,了解它是如何帮助企业提升效率、改善决策的。

案例1: 销售数据分析

一家零售公司使用“Poco”对其销售数据进行了深入分析。通过对历史销售记录的细致梳理,他们发现了一些有趣的模式:某些产品的销量在特定季节会有显著增长。基于这一发现,公司调整了库存策略,确保在这些季节有足够的库存,从而显著提高了销售额。

案例2: 客户行为研究

另一家电商企业则利用“Poco”来研究客户行为。通过对客户购买历史的分析,他们识别出了高价值客户群体,并针对这些客户推出了定制化的营销活动。这一举措不仅增强了客户忠诚度,还带来了显著的收入增长。

案例3: 运营效率提升

一家制造型企业通过“Poco”对其生产流程进行了优化。通过对生产线上的数据进行实时监控和分析,他们发现了生产瓶颈所在,并采取措施加以改进。这一系列改变不仅提高了生产效率,还减少了浪费,为企业节省了大量的成本。

通过这些案例,我们可以看到“Poco”在实际应用中的巨大潜力。它不仅能够帮助企业更好地理解数据,还能促进更明智的决策制定,最终推动业务的成功。

五、Poco的评估

5.1 Poco的优点

在当今这个数据驱动的世界里,寻找一款既能满足数据分析需求又能兼顾用户体验的工具实属不易。然而,“Poco”却以其独特的魅力脱颖而出,成为众多企业和组织的首选。让我们一起深入探讨“Poco”的几大优点,感受它如何在数据的海洋中引领风潮。

简洁高效的界面设计

“Poco”的界面设计简洁明了,即便是初次接触数据分析的人也能迅速上手。它摒弃了繁复的操作流程,将重点放在了数据本身。这种设计理念不仅提升了用户的使用体验,还极大地缩短了学习曲线,让人们能够更快地投入到实际工作中去。

强大的数据处理能力

尽管“Poco”的名字意为“小”,但它在数据处理方面却毫不逊色。无论是海量的数据集还是复杂的查询需求,“Poco”都能轻松应对。其背后强大的数据处理引擎确保了即使在处理大量数据时也能保持流畅的操作体验,这对于那些需要频繁处理大数据的企业来说无疑是一大福音。

灵活的数据接入方式

“Poco”支持多种数据源接入,包括SQL数据库、CSV文件等多种格式。这种灵活性使得数据整合变得异常简便,用户无需担心数据格式的问题,便能将注意力集中在数据分析本身上。无论是内部数据库还是外部数据源,“Poco”都能轻松接入,极大地扩展了数据来源的可能性。

丰富的可视化选项

“Poco”提供了多样化的图表类型,如柱状图、折线图、饼图等,帮助用户从不同角度解读数据。这些图表不仅美观大方,而且能够直观地展示数据的趋势和分布情况。更重要的是,用户只需简单地拖拽字段到图表区域,即可生成相应的图表,大大降低了制作图表的技术门槛。

定制化的报告制作

除了图表之外,“Poco”还允许用户创建个性化的报告模板。这意味着用户可以根据自己的需求,自由地安排报告的结构和布局,甚至可以添加文字说明和图片,使得报告内容更加丰富多样。这种高度的定制化,不仅提升了报告的专业度,也让分享成果变得更加容易。

5.2 Poco的局限

尽管“Poco”在许多方面表现出色,但它也有一些局限性需要注意。

不含OLAP服务器或数据挖掘解决方案

“Poco”本身并不包含OLAP服务器或数据挖掘解决方案,这意味着对于那些需要进行复杂数据分析和挖掘任务的企业来说,可能需要额外的工具或服务来补充“Poco”的功能。

对于高级用户的功能限制

虽然“Poco”对于初学者来说非常友好,但对于那些有着更高数据分析需求的用户而言,可能会觉得它的某些功能有所限制。例如,对于需要进行高级统计分析或机器学习任务的用户来说,“Poco”可能无法完全满足他们的需求。

技术支持和社区资源

相比于一些成熟的商业数据分析工具,“Poco”的技术支持和社区资源相对较少。这意味着在遇到问题时,用户可能需要花费更多的时间去寻找解决方案。

尽管存在这些局限性,但“Poco”仍然是一款值得推荐的数据分析工具,尤其适合那些寻求轻量级、易于使用的解决方案的企业和个人。通过不断地迭代更新,“Poco”也在逐步完善自身,努力满足更多用户的需求。

六、总结

通过本文的介绍,我们深入了解了“Poco”这款轻量级在线分析处理工具的强大功能和独特优势。它不仅提供了简洁高效的界面设计,还具备强大的数据处理能力和灵活的数据接入方式,使得数据分析变得更加简单直观。此外,“Poco”丰富的可视化选项和定制化的报告制作功能,让用户能够轻松地将复杂的数据转化为易于理解的故事,为决策提供有力支持。

尽管“Poco”在某些方面存在局限,例如不包含OLAP服务器或数据挖掘解决方案,以及对于高级用户的功能限制,但它仍然是一个非常适合初学者和寻求轻量级解决方案的企业和个人的选择。随着不断的迭代更新,“Poco”将继续完善自身,以更好地满足用户的需求。总之,“Poco”以其独特的魅力,在数据驱动的世界里引领着新的风潮。